Job description for Assistant Factory Manager at Tasblock Industry Indonesia

We are looking for a highly energetic, organized, and technical Assistant Factory Manager to support the end-to-end operational management of our composite manufacturing facility in Cikande. Reporting directly to the Factory Manager, you will act as a critical bridge between strategic planning and direct floor execution, taking on a deeply hands-on role in driving plant performance.

Our plant specializes in composite manufacturing, specifically producing Sheet Molding Compound (SMC) and pultrusion profiles. The facility encompasses advanced heavy machinery including press machines and custom moulds, dedicated assembly and finishing departments, and a high-volume custom fabrication line for street furniture utilizing both CNC and manual cutting processes.

The ideal candidate will actively run day-to-day production floors, supervise the workforce, champion safety compliance, and support external stakeholder relations to ensure seamless execution from raw material intake to final delivery.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

1. Direct Floor Production & Workflow Supervision

Support the Factory Manager in overseeing multi-stage workflows, directly tracking daily targets across the molding (SMC, pultrusion), secondary machining (CNC/manual cutting), assembly, and finishing departments.

Monitor equipment health and efficiency, working closely with maintenance to ensure optimal runtime for heavy press machines, specialized pultrusion lines, and custom moulds.

Oversee day-to-day quality checks and ground logistics, from raw material acceptance inspection to final finished good packaging and dispatch.

2. Workforce Management & On-Floor Leadership

Directly supervise shift supervisors, specialized machine operators, assembly teams, and craftsmen to maintain a disciplined and productive environment.

Manage daily shift schedules, monitor workforce attendance, allocate tasks effectively, and assist in floor level conflict resolution.

Conduct on-the-job training for workers regarding operational precision, equipment usage, and manufacturing techniques.

3. Housekeeping, Security & 5S Enforcement

Enforce strict housekeeping and 5S protocols on a daily basis across all raw material zones, production areas, cutting rooms, and finishing floors.

Work closely with the site security team to monitor access protocols, safeguarding technical tools, specialized moulds, and plant assets.

4. Safety, EHS Compliance & Documentation

Execute and enforce strict Environment, Health, and Safety (EHS) procedures on the floor, identifying potential hazards around press machines and cutting environments to achieve zero accidents.

Assist the Factory Manager in maintaining and updating standard operating procedures (SOPs), production logs, quality documentation, and regulatory compliance records.

5. External & Community Liaison Support

Assist the Factory Manager in maintaining proactive, positive relations with local community neighbors and surrounding local groups.

Support communications and coordinate routine site visits from municipal or regulatory government officials to ensure constant plant compliance.


RE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S & SKILLS

Education: Bachelor’s Degree in Engineering (Mechanical, Industrial, Chemical, Materials Science, or a related technical discipline).

Experience: 4+ years of hands-on experience in manufacturing operations, ideally as a Production Supervisor, Production Engineer, or Assistant Plant Manager.

Technical Expertise (Highly Preferred / Plus): Familiarity with polymers, composite materials, compression molding (SMC), pultrusion lines, industrial press machinery, and tooling/moulds. Practical exposure to CNC machinery and precision manual cutting processes is a significant advantage.

Leadership Style: Intensely "hands-on." Must prefer spending the vast majority of the workday on the factory floor directly guiding work crews and managing operational friction.

Skills: Excellent task-coordination, communication, and interpersonal skills; capable of handling local community environments and government compliance requirements effectively.
